I think the tax "issues" of most, if not all, eircom League clubs are well known to the dogs in the street (or at least those on the terraces and in the stands) but are conveniently ignored by many stakeholders. Revenue are another matter though and may not treat all clubs as leniently as they did Rovers last year when, as part of the examinership settlement, they accepted just €40,000 (or 2.67%) as sufficient to discharge the €1,500,000 in outstanding tax liabilities that they owed.
